How can I implement geometric and probabilstic shaping in a coherent optical system using optisystem17. Are there functionalities possible in optisystem?
Dear Zahid,
Currently, OptiSystem doesn’t support probabilistic shaping. However, you may use the Matlab component in OptiSystem to add your code to shape the transmitted pulse.
Examples on how to use the Matlab component are found at the following link.
C:\Users\USER NAME\Documents\OptiSystem 17.0 Samples\Software interworking\MATLAB co-simulation
We are in process of adding this feature in the coming main release 18.0.
